To accommodate modern engineering workflows, the book presents design methodologies in algorithmic steps. This makes it incredibly straightforward for students and engineers to program these formulas into MATLAB, Python, or Excel spreadsheets to automate design iterations. The primary purpose of General Aviation Aircraft Design is to support the aircraft designer by providing practical and effective scientific methods and procedures. While many textbooks are rich in theoretical derivations, they often leave the reader wondering, "How do I actually use this to size my horizontal tail?" Dr. Gudmundsson’s book is designed to answer that question directly.
